Giants Edge Rebels in OT

Vancouver, B.C. - The Vancouver Giants decided to use a little overtime for their first game in 2009. Mikhail Fisenko scored the game winner with just under one minute to go in the extra frame as the Vancouver Giants outlasted the Red Deer Rebels 2-1 at the Pacific Coliseum.

After a scoreless first forty minutes, the Giants were able to draw first blood on the power play, just their second of the game. Craig Schira was able to fire a shot through traffic from the point at 8:35 to open the scoring for Vancouver. Schira was able to work his way to the top of the slot after a nice pass from Brent Regner and his smart wrist shot found a way through the screened Rebels net minder Darcy Kuemper.

Red Deer would fight back however, and pulled their goalie with over two minutes to play. In the ensuing bedlam in the Giants end, Burnaby resident Landon Ferraro was able to spot Maple Ridge's Connor Redmond across the crease with a perfect feed. Redmond tipped home the pass at 18:17 of the third to tie the game at one and send us to overtime.

In OT, both teams traded quality chances. Late in the extra frame, Giants d-man Mike Berube was able to break up a long pass at his own blueline. Berube immediately turned up ice to find a lonely Mikhail Fisenko down the left wing side boards. Fisenko accepted the pass, and using Casey Pierro-Zabotel as a decoy, snapped a wrist shot under the crossbar, top shelf past Kuemper for the OT winner. Fisenko's 8th of the season at 4:21 of overtime proved to be the difference on the evening.

Vancouver wins their first overtime game of the season and improves their record to 32-2-0-3. Tyson Sexsmith was solid between the pipes for the G-Men and picks up his 21st win of the season. Darcy Kuemper was also good in goal for the Rebs, but picks up the OT loss and falls to 11-11-1-3.

Next up, the Giants play their last home game until late January as the Kamloops Blazers pay a visit to the Rink on Renfrew.
